summ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authortkellner <tkellner@3a0b52a2-8410-0410-bc02-ff6273a87459>2012-08-24 17:05:49 +0000
committertkellner <tkellner@3a0b52a2-8410-0410-bc02-ff6273a87459>2012-08-24 17:05:49 +0000
commitee39c68248d511cb63e9b30506201fd19a2e400a (patch)
treef5304d2578750678e1647cbef84612e3dd65720d
parentfe0792b721755bee25c8cdd62c417f16f09fc1c1 (diff)
downloadpdf-over-ee39c68248d511cb63e9b30506201fd19a2e400a.tar.gz
pdf-over-ee39c68248d511cb63e9b30506201fd19a2e400a.tar.bz2
pdf-over-ee39c68248d511cb63e9b30506201fd19a2e400a.zip
Use SelectionAdapter to make code more concise
git-svn-id: https://svn.iaik.tugraz.at/svn/egiz/prj/current/12PDF-OVER-4.0@12400 3a0b52a2-8410-0410-bc02-ff6273a87459
-rw-r--r--trunk/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/DataSourceSelectComposite.java18
1 files changed, 3 insertions, 15 deletions
diff --git a/trunk/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/DataSourceSelectComposite.java b/trunk/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/DataSourceSelectComposite.java
index 9b6539d2..18dcd9c2 100644
--- a/trunk/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/DataSourceSelectComposite.java
+++ b/trunk/pdf-over-gui/src/main/java/at/asit/pdfover/gui/composites/DataSourceSelectComposite.java
@@ -25,8 +25,8 @@ import org.eclipse.swt.dnd.DropTargetEvent;
import org.eclipse.swt.dnd.DropTargetListener;
import org.eclipse.swt.dnd.FileTransfer;
import org.eclipse.swt.dnd.Transfer;
+import org.eclipse.swt.events.SelectionAdapter;
import org.eclipse.swt.events.SelectionEvent;
-import org.eclipse.swt.events.SelectionListener;
import org.eclipse.swt.graphics.Color;
import org.eclipse.swt.graphics.Font;
import org.eclipse.swt.graphics.FontData;
@@ -53,14 +53,7 @@ public class DataSourceSelectComposite extends StateComposite {
/**
*
*/
- private final class FileBrowseDialog implements SelectionListener {
- /**
- *
- */
- public FileBrowseDialog() {
- // Nothing to do here
- }
-
+ private final class FileBrowseDialogListener extends SelectionAdapter {
@Override
public void widgetSelected(SelectionEvent e) {
FileDialog dialog = new FileDialog(DataSourceSelectComposite.this.getShell(), SWT.OPEN);
@@ -75,11 +68,6 @@ public class DataSourceSelectComposite extends StateComposite {
}
}
}
-
- @Override
- public void widgetDefaultSelected(SelectionEvent e) {
- // Nothing to do here
- }
}
/**
@@ -241,7 +229,7 @@ public class DataSourceSelectComposite extends StateComposite {
fd_btn_open.bottom = new FormAttachment(100, -5);
btn_open.setLayoutData(fd_btn_open);
btn_open.setBackground(back);
- btn_open.addSelectionListener(new FileBrowseDialog());
+ btn_open.addSelectionListener(new FileBrowseDialogListener());
this.drop_area.pack();
/*